'Highly recommended. Crime Writing at its very best' β Kate Rhodes on The Last Straw, book 1 in the DCI Warren Jones series When Jillian Gwinnet is found dead β strangled in her office β it's a shocking and perplexing case for DCI Warren Jones.Β She was a trusted and respected member of the community. Deputy Head of Sacred Heart Catholic Academy, she had an unblemished record and had been a formidable force in the school for years.Β Who would kill this woman β a woman who had dedicated her life to supporting others? The deeper Warren delves, the darker the possible motives become...
